Navigation System DTC Troubleshooting: 1301
DTC 1301:
GPS Antenna Error
NOTE:
- Check the vehicle battery condition first Battery Test.
- This navigation DTC sets when there is poor connectors or loose terminals at the GPS antenna connector or an open in GPS antenna lead.
- Before you troubleshoot, make sure to follow the general troubleshooting information Reading and Clearing Diagnostic Trouble Codes.
- Check any official Honda service website for more service information about the navigation system.
1. Clear the hard error code.
2. Turn the ignition switch to LOCK (0), and then back to ON (II).
3. Check for the hard error code.
Is DTC 1301 indicated?
YES -
The failure is duplicated, go to step 4.
NO -
Intermittent failure, the system is OK at this time.
4. Turn the ignition switch to LOCK (0).
5. Substitute a known-good GPS antenna Service and Repair.
6. Clear the hard error code.
7. Turn the ignition switch to LOCK (0), and then back to ON (II).
8. Check for the hard error code.
Is DTC 1301 indicated?
YES -
Replace the audio-navigation unit Audio-Navigation Unit Removal/Installation (With Navigation).
NO -
Replace the original GPS antenna Service and Repair.
